> Current version of genksyms doesn't know anything about __typeof_unqual__()
> operator.  Avoid the usage of __typeof_unqual__() with genksyms to prevent
> errors when symbols are versioned.
>
> There were no problems with gendwarfksyms.

Why don't you add it to the genksyms keyword table?


diff --git a/scripts/genksyms/keywords.c b/scripts/genksyms/keywords.c
index b85e0979a00c..901baf632ed2 100644
--- a/scripts/genksyms/keywords.c
+++ b/scripts/genksyms/keywords.c
@@ -17,6 +17,7 @@ static struct resword {
        { "__signed__", SIGNED_KEYW },
        { "__typeof", TYPEOF_KEYW },
        { "__typeof__", TYPEOF_KEYW },
+       { "__typeof_unqual__", TYPEOF_KEYW },
        { "__volatile", VOLATILE_KEYW },
        { "__volatile__", VOLATILE_KEYW },
        { "__builtin_va_list", VA_LIST_KEYW },
